The network-bridge script tries to automatically find the default
network interface number with the following ligne:
vifnum=${vifnum:-$(ip route list | awk '/^default / { print $NF }' | sed
's/^[^0-9]*//')}
However, this fails on mandriva, because the parsed line is:
default via 193.55.250.126 dev eth0 metric 10
This causes many troubles, such as:
http://article.gmane.org/gmane.comp.emulators.xen.user/17846
A simple solution is to change the position-based parsing to something
more robust:
vifnum=${vifnum:-$(ip route list 0.0.0.0/0 | sed 's/.*dev
[^0-9]\+\([0-9]\+\).*$/1円/')}
This is also more robust against default interfaces that would be named
otherwise as dev[0-9].
